| dc.description.abstract | Gender differences in pharmaceutical development and responsiveness to therapeutic treatments have been demonstrated. In 6 male and 6 female normal volunteers, the researchers measured the diuretic response of oral furosemide. Every patient was given a single dose of furosemide .Over the next 6 hours, total urine production was collected for volume measurement, mean of urine output in male (468.0) more than in female (367.2), urine output amount (P=0.142) with respect to urine flow rate, among the treatments. there were no statistical significant different between gender . | en_US |
